Understanding what typically causes water damage in Gainesboro can help you catch a problem early — before it turns into a full emergency call.
Supply lines behind washing machines, dishwashers, and refrigerators wear out over time. When they fail, water can spread through a Gainesboro property for hours before anyone notices, soaking into flooring and cabinetry.
Heavy storms, wind-driven rain, and aging roofing materials all contribute to water intrusion in Gainesboro homes and businesses, especially in older roof systems nearing the end of their lifespan.
Clogged municipal lines, tree root intrusion, and sump pump failures can send contaminated water back into Gainesboro basements and lower levels, requiring specialized cleanup and sanitizing.
Water heaters, washing machines, dishwashers, and HVAC condensation lines are common — and often overlooked — sources of slow leaks that eventually cause significant damage in Gainesboro properties if left unnoticed.
Improper grading around a Gainesboro property's foundation can direct rainwater toward the structure instead of away from it, leading to chronic basement or crawlspace moisture over time.
Water used to extinguish a fire, or an accidental sprinkler discharge, can leave a Gainesboro property with significant secondary water damage that needs immediate attention right after the fire crew leaves.

Plenty of Gainesboro homeowners try to handle a small water event themselves before calling us. Here's what usually gets missed.
What makes DIY cleanup risky isn't the initial mop-up — it's everything you can't see afterward. Standard household fans move air across a surface, but they don't pull moisture out of building materials the way commercial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ers do. That gap is exactly where Gainesboro homeowners end up with mold problems weeks or months down the line.
There's also the insurance side to consider. Without professional documentation — moisture readings, photos, a written scope of work — it can be much harder to support a claim if secondary damage shows up later. Our Gainesboro technicians build that documentation as part of every job, protecting you if issues surface down the road.
None of this means every spill needs a professional crew — a small, contained, surface-level spill that's dried within a few hours is usually fine to handle yourself. But once water has soaked into flooring, baseboards, or drywall, or if it's been sitting for more than a few hours, it's worth a call to make sure nothing's hiding beneath the surface.
The minutes before our Gainesboro crew arrives matter. Here's what our dispatchers typically recommend, situation permitting.
If the water is coming from a pipe, appliance, or fixture you can safely reach, shut off the supply valve or main.
Never touch electrical switches, outlets, or appliances that are wet or near standing water — the risk of shock is real.
Lifting rugs, moving boxes, and relocating valuables can reduce secondary damage while you wait for our team.
Snap photos or video of the affected areas before anything is moved — this helps your insurance claim later.
If weather allows, opening windows or doors can help slow humidity buildup until our Gainesboro team arrives with drying equipment.
Delaying the call is the most common mistake we see. Standing water only gets more expensive to fix the longer it sits.
